What does Test Rite International Co do?

Test Rite International Co Ltd is a Taiwanese company that has evolved into a global corporation with numerous product divisions since its establishment in 1981. The company primarily focuses on the manufacturing and distribution of consumer goods, including household items, electronic products, as well as hardware and garden supplies. Test Rite's headquarters is located in Taipei, Taiwan. History of the company Test Rite was founded in 1981 by James Wu and initially started as a small importer of goods such as tools, hardware, and DIY supplies. The company rapidly expanded in the 1990s and was able to increase its revenue through the transition to private labels and the introduction of new products. It has since become one of Taiwan's leading companies, operating globally. Business model Test Rite's business concept is based on an efficient and transparent value chain that is focused on the utilization of cutting-edge technologies and services. An important success factor is the extensive network of production facilities in Asia that enables the company to operate cost-effectively. Company divisions Test Rite operates in a variety of sectors, including household items, hardware and garden supplies, electronics, and toys. The various divisions are marketed under different brand names such as Bonny, Simplicity, Style Selections, and Garden Oasis. Each brand is targeted towards a specific market and has its own identity and target audience. Products by Test Rite Test Rite offers a wide range of consumer goods, including household items such as tableware, kitchen utensils, chopping boards, irons, vacuum cleaners, and many more products. The hardware and garden supplies brand, Garden Oasis, offers products such as outdoor furniture, umbrellas, grills, and outdoor lighting. The electronics division includes brands such as Durabrand, Emerson, and Magnavox, offering television sets, DVD players, and other entertainment electronics.
